[ARM] CPUFREQ: S3C24XX serial CPU frequency scaling support.



Add support for CPU frequency scalling to the S3C24XX serial
driver.

#ifdef CONFIG_CPU_FREQ

static int s3c24xx_serial_cpufreq_transition(struct notifier_block *nb,
					     unsigned long val, void *data)
{
	struct s3c24xx_uart_port *port;
	struct uart_port *uport;

	port = container_of(nb, struct s3c24xx_uart_port, freq_transition);
	uport = &port->port;

	/* check to see if port is enabled */

	if (port->pm_level != 0)
		return 0;

	/* try and work out if the baudrate is changing, we can detect
	 * a change in rate, but we do not have support for detecting
	 * a disturbance in the clock-rate over the change.
	 */

	if (IS_ERR(port->clk))
		goto exit;

	if (port->baudclk_rate == clk_get_rate(port->clk))
		goto exit;

	if (val == CPUFREQ_PRECHANGE) {
		/* we should really shut the port down whilst the
		 * frequency change is in progress. */

	} else if (val == CPUFREQ_POSTCHANGE) {
		struct ktermios *termios;
		struct tty_struct *tty;

		if (uport->info == NULL) {
			printk(KERN_WARNING "%s: info NULL\n", __func__);
			goto exit;
		}

		tty = uport->info->port.tty;

		if (tty == NULL) {
			printk(KERN_WARNING "%s: tty is NULL\n", __func__);
			goto exit;
		}

		termios = tty->termios;

		if (termios == NULL) {
			printk(KERN_WARNING "%s: no termios?\n", __func__);
			goto exit;
		}

		s3c24xx_serial_set_termios(uport, termios, NULL);
	}

 exit:
	return 0;
}

static inline int s3c24xx_serial_cpufreq_register(struct s3c24xx_uart_port *port)
{
	port->freq_transition.notifier_call = s3c24xx_serial_cpufreq_transition;

	return cpufreq_register_notifier(&port->freq_transition,
					 CPUFREQ_TRANSITION_NOTIFIER);
}

static inline void s3c24xx_serial_cpufreq_deregister(struct s3c24xx_uart_port *port)
{
	cpufreq_unregister_notifier(&port->freq_transition,
				    CPUFREQ_TRANSITION_NOTIFIER);
}

#else
static inline int s3c24xx_serial_cpufreq_register(struct s3c24xx_uart_port *port)
{
	return 0;
}

static inline void s3c24xx_serial_cpufreq_deregister(struct s3c24xx_uart_port *port)
{
}
#endif
